低带宽VPS能做什么?
| 用途类别 |
具体应用场景 |
优势说明 |
| 轻量级网站托管 |
个人博客、小型企业官网 |
资源占用低,成本效益高 |
| 开发测试环境 |
代码调试、功能测试 |
隔离性强,可快速部署 |
| 远程办公 |
SSH连接、文件传输 |
稳定连接,适合低带宽需求 |
| 数据采集 |
爬虫脚本运行、定时任务 |
长期在线,任务执行可靠 |
| 私有云存储 |
个人文件备份、小型数据库 |
数据自主控制,安全性高 |
低带宽VPS的用途与操作指南
低带宽VPS的核心应用场景
低带宽VPS(虚拟专用服务器)虽然网络带宽有限,但凭借其稳定性和资源隔离特性,在以下领域表现突出:
- 轻量级网站托管
适合日均访问量低于1000次的个人博客或小型企业官网。通过优化图片压缩和启用缓存机制(如Nginx FastCGI缓存),可显著降低带宽消耗。典型配置建议:
# Nginx缓存配置示例
fastcgicachepath /var/cache/nginx levels=1:2 keyszone=mycache:10m;
fastcgicachekey "$scheme$requestmethod$host$requesturi";
- 开发测试环境
为开发者提供隔离的沙箱环境,可部署Docker容器进行多版本测试。推荐使用轻量级工具链:
- 代码编辑器:VS Code Server
- 版本控制:GitLab Runner
- 测试框架:PyTest/Pytest
- 远程办公支持
通过SSH隧道实现安全连接,配合tmux或screen工具可保持会话持久化。文件传输建议使用rsync增量同步:
rsync -avz --delete /local/path user@vip:/remote/path
典型问题解决方案
| 问题现象 |
根本原因 |
优化方案 |
| 网页加载缓慢 |
未启用压缩和缓存 |
配置Gzip压缩和浏览器缓存 |
| SSH连接超时 |
网络波动或带宽限制 |
改用TCP加速工具如BBR |
| 定时任务执行失败 |
系统资源不足 |
调整cron执行频率和内存分配 |
性能优化建议
- 网络层面
优先使用UDP协议的应用(如WireGuard VPN),相比TCP可降低30%的带宽开销。监控工具推荐:
iftop -i eth0 # 实时流量监控
- 系统配置
禁用非必要服务(如蓝牙、打印服务),将swappiness值调低至10减少交换:
echo "vm.swappiness=10" | sudo tee -a /etc/sysctl.conf
- 应用选择
选用内存占用低于50MB的轻量级软件:
- 数据库:SQLite
- Web服务器:Caddy
- 监控:Netdata
通过合理配置和工具选择,低带宽VPS完全能满足特定场景下的稳定运行需求。关键是根据实际业务特点进行针对性优化,避免资源浪费。
发表评论